NOMINATION RULES:

1) Nominations will start Saturday, July 20th and end at the end of Saturday, July 27th, for a total of 7 days.

2) Each day starts at 10pm EDT (UTC-04:00), and ends exactly 24 hours after a new day post is made. You may nominate one game using the format provided. Please try to nominate with the "weakest perceived" song in Slot 1, and the "strongest perceived" song in Slot 6. It will be advantageous to keep this in mind with regards to how the lineup will affect when songs are played as detailed in the "Contest Format and Voting Rules" below.

Game: [game name]
1: [song name] - [song link]
2: [song name] - [song link]
3: [song name] - [song link]
4: [song name] - [song link]
5: [song name] - [song link]
6: [song name] - [song link]
Alt: [song name] - [song link]

3) If you miss a day of nomination, you have a grace period during the very next day to make it up. 24 hours after a missed day ends, the nomination cannot be made up unless the host was notified earlier.

4) You are responsible for the games that you nominate! You must be willing to take feedback on your lineup and adjust to what potential supports think, but ultimately it is your decision. Extreme cases of "taking soundtracks hostage" will be dealt with by the host if necessary. Do note the removal of "alternate set lists" that have been a thing in the past.

5) You can make edits to your lineup at any point until two days after the end of nominations, on Monday, July 29th at 10pm EDT.

6) As long as every song in its lineup follows eligibility rules, any video games' soundtrack may be nominated! Fan games, visual novels, rhythm games, ROM hacks, etc. all will work. Similar "could argued to be like a game" works such as Homestuck are acceptable.

7) Unreleased games may be nominated if: a complete official soundtrack has been released, the game was completed but cancelled, or the game is in early access.

8) Songs from add-ons and expansions are to be added to a nomination of the base game. Episodic games can be nominated under a common name if there is significant overlap in used music, such as .hack or Umineko no Naku Koro ni. Do note that Umineko and Umineko Chiru are counted as different games in this case.

9) Past champions of the contest may not be nominated, which includes: Ar tonelico II: Melody of Metafalica, Shatter, Atelier Ayesha: The Alchemist of Dusk, and Bravely Default: Flying Fairy.

SUPPORT RULES:

1) Beginning concurrently with the nomination phase on Saturday, July 20th at 10pm EDT, you will be able to support another members soundtrack nomination in the nomination thread by giving it a "Support Vote (SV)". This support period will end several days after nominations conclude, on Wednesday, July 31st at 10pm EDT.

2) To support a soundtrack, simply make a post with a statement of support. You may support any numbers of soundtracks as you like, and may support multiple at once. Make it very clear that you are supporting, and what specific games you are supporting in your post.

3) You may not add an SV to your own nominations.

4) You will not be able to retract an SV, unless the songlist has been changed since you supported the game.
